Kennebunkport approves three town ballots
KENNEBUNKPORT — Results are in from Tuesday’s election in Kennebunkport; voters approved all three municipal ballot questions. In addition to voting on three town referendums, voters chose 329-98 to validate the Regional School Unit 21 budget, a figure of almost $45.8 million. AWS appoints YCCC president to board of directors
KENNEBUNK — The Animal Welfare Society in Kennebunk announced Monday it has approved the appointment of York County Community College President Dr. Barbara Finkelstein to its board of directors.
